Philadelphia, PA (Sports Network) - Andre Iguodala scored a game-high 24 points, and Elton Brand added 21 points and seven rebounds, as the Philadelphia 76ers routed the Minnesota Timberwolves, 119-97.
Both teams came in with season-high four-game winning streaks, but it was the Sixers that continued to turn the corner in an otherwise disappointing season.
Lou Williams helped the cause with 16 points and seven assists off the bench, while Thaddeus Young and Willie Green each scored 15 points for Philadelphia, which made 61.4 percent from the field in the first half to build a 22-point halftime lead.
Wayne Ellington, a Philadelphia-area native, led Minnesota with 16 points. Corey Brewer and Jonny Flynn each netted 14 points, while Al Jefferson had 12 to go with 10 rebounds in the loss.
